Document Description
The Walnut Business Park is a proposed development of four concrete tilt-up buildings that would encompass a total of 414,778 square feet of building space. The buildings would include 392,488 square feet of warehousing space, of which up to 53,549 square feet may be refrigerated, and 22,290 square feet of office/retail space. The buildings would be designed for multiuse, with the South Lemon Avenue frontage catering to retail and office uses, and the warehouse and manufacturing uses in the interior of the site. Food and beverage pick-up and e-commerce last-mile tenants are also possible future tenants. Any prospective user must be either permitted by right or conditionally permitted under the Walnut Zoning Code. Cold storage uses would be allowed in Buildings 1 and 4. The proposed project would include 1,097 parking stalls and 115,026 square feet of landscaping.
